reports CDC data reveal that more than one in seven “adults across all U.S. states and territories are physically inactive.” Investigators arrived at this conclusion after compiling “2015-2018 data collected as part of the CDC’s Behavioral Risk Factor Surveillance System, which is a telephone-based survey of people’s health activities, chronic conditions, and use of preventive health services.” The study revealed that “Colorado ranked lowest, with 17.3% of people physically inactive, compared to Puerto Rico, which had the highest total at 47.7%.”
